Upcoming Syria Poll Won’t Include Restive Suweida Province, Officials Say

Security forces take aim from a rooftop during clashes in the majority-Druze Suweida province, Syria, on July 16, 2025. Bakr Alaksem/AFP via Getty Images

Syria’s first parliamentary election under its new Islamist leadership, set for September, will not include the strife-torn southern province of Suweida and the northeastern Raqqa and Hasaka provinces, according to Syrian officials.

Over the weekend, Syrian news outlet Ekhbariya, citing an electoral commission official, reported that voting in the three provinces would be postponed until “appropriate conditions” for conducting polls are in place.
